Gears are mechanical elements that are typically used to transmit rotational motion and force. They work by meshing teeth with each other to change speed, direction of torque, or to transfer power between multiple shafts. Gears are an integral part of mechanical engineering and are widely used in a variety of mechanical devices.

**1. What materials are used in these gears?**
The gears are made from high-quality alloy steel, such as 20CrMnTi or 42CrMo, which undergo heat treatment processes like carburizing or quenching. This ensures exceptional hardness, wear resistance, and durability, making them suitable for heavy-load, high-torque operations in industrial machinery and automotive systems.
**2. How does the forging and hobbing process enhance gear performance?**
Forging improves the metal’s grain structure, boosting strength and fatigue resistance. Hobbing—a precision cutting process—creates accurate tooth profiles with smooth surfaces, ensuring minimal noise and vibration. Combined, these processes result in gears with superior load capacity, longevity, and efficiency in power transmission.
**3. What applications are these gears designed for?**
These gears are used in heavy-duty machinery, including construction equipment, mining systems, wind turbines, and automotive differentials. They are ideal for applications requiring precise motion control, such as slew drives, rack-and-pinion systems, and worm gear reducers, where high torque and shock resistance are critical.
